上一页 1 ··· 77 78 79 80 81 82 83 84 85 ··· 102 下一页
摘要: 本节阐述了一个完整的 Python 项目结构,你可以使用什么样的目录布局以及怎样发布软件到网络上。 创建Python项目 我们的实验项目名为 factorial,放到 /home/shiyanlou/factorial 目录: 我们给将要创建的 Python 模块取名为 myfact,因此我们下一步 阅读全文
posted @ 2019-02-21 16:05 Rogn 阅读(1042) 评论(0) 推荐(0)
摘要: 前一段时间在阿里云上注册了一个 .top域名附送了一个企业邮箱,想起来了就使用一下。 登录阿里云,打开控制台,企业邮箱设置入口由于管理控制台的域名与网站(万网)下。 由于是赠送的解析什么的都已经自动弄好了,我们只要去设置一下管理员密码。点击管理,选择重置密码,设置登录密码(这里我记不得初始状态是否有 阅读全文
posted @ 2019-02-19 16:41 Rogn 阅读(2042) 评论(0) 推荐(0)
摘要: 在2010年6月的更新(也是迄今为止最新的更新)后,其源代码支持编译为Windows平台的可执行程序。而且此工具使用C语言开发编写,不需要TUN/TAP,所以大大加强了它的可用性。 下载 当前最新的0.5.2版源代码下载请点击这里 Windows下客户端可执行文件下载请点击这里 安装 本配置所在环境 阅读全文
posted @ 2019-02-19 14:33 Rogn 阅读(8596) 评论(0) 推荐(0)
摘要: 编写测试检验应用程序所有不同的功能。每一个测试集中在一个关注点上验证结果是不是期望的。定期执行测试确保应用程序按预期的工作。当测试覆盖很大的时候,通过运行测试你就有自信确保修改点和新增点不会影响应用程序。 测试范围 如果可能的话,代码库中的所有代码都要测试。但这取决于开发者,如果写一个健壮性测试是不 阅读全文
posted @ 2019-02-18 23:19 Rogn 阅读(775) 评论(0) 推荐(0)
摘要: 虚拟的 Python 环境(简称 venv) 是一个能帮助你在本地目录安装不同版本的 Python 模块的 Python 环境,你可以不再需要在你系统中安装所有东西就能开发并测试你的代码。 安装Virtualenv 首先打开终端输入下面的命令来更新安装源和下载pip3: 用如下命令安装 virtua 阅读全文
posted @ 2019-02-18 22:13 Rogn 阅读(407) 评论(0) 推荐(0)
摘要: 在这个实验里我们学习迭代器、生成器、装饰器有关知识。 这几个概念是 Python 中不容易理解透彻的概念,务必把所有的实验代码都完整的输入并理解清楚其中每一行的意思。 迭代器 Python 迭代器(Iterators)对象在遵守迭代器协议时需要支持如下两种方法: __iter__(),返回迭代器对象 阅读全文
posted @ 2019-02-18 21:49 Rogn 阅读(448) 评论(0) 推荐(0)
摘要: 编程语言不是艺术,而是工作或者说是工具,所以整理并遵循一套编码规范是十分必要的。 这篇文章原文实际上来自于这里:https://www.python.org/dev/peps/pep-0008/ 有很多规范,这里只讲其中一部分。 代码排版 缩进 每层缩进使用4个空格。 续行要么与圆括号、中括号、花括 阅读全文
posted @ 2019-02-18 18:53 Rogn 阅读(906) 评论(0) 推荐(0)
摘要: collections 是 Python 内建的一个集合模块,提供了许多有用的集合类。 在这个实验我们会学习 Collections 模块。这个模块实现了一些很好的数据结构,它们能帮助你解决各种实际问题。 这是如何导入这个模块,现在我们来看看其中的一些类。 Counter Counter 是一个有助 阅读全文
posted @ 2019-02-16 21:40 Rogn 阅读(370) 评论(0) 推荐(0)
摘要: 在这节我们将要学习 Python 模块相关知识。包括模块的概念和导入方法,包的概念和使用,第三方模块的介绍,命令行参数的使用等。 模块 到目前为止,我们在 Python 解释器中写的所有代码都在我们退出解释器的时候丢失了。但是当人们编写大型程序的时候他们会倾向于将代码分为多个不同的文件以便使用,调试 阅读全文
posted @ 2019-02-16 17:28 Rogn 阅读(671) 评论(0) 推荐(0)
摘要: 本节中将通过定义一些简单的 Python 类,来学习 Python 面向对象编程的基本概念。 定义类 在写你的第一个类之前,你应该知道它的语法。我们以下面这种方式定义类: 在类的声明中你可以写任何 Python 语句,包括定义变量(在类中称为属性)、定义函数(在类中我们称为方法)。 __init__ 阅读全文
posted @ 2019-02-15 17:43 Rogn 阅读(512) 评论(0) 推荐(0)
上一页 1 ··· 77 78 79 80 81 82 83 84 85 ··· 102 下一页